Posting Summary

Rutgers University-Camden is seeking a Research Aide (Eligibility Program Specialist) for the Cumberland County Territory for CCR&R. Under the direction of the Site Manager, the Research Aide (Eligibility Program Specialist) appropriately administers state and federal child care subsidies, data storage and documentation procedures that meet administrative and program quality audits, and fiscal oversight. S/he will manage the daily eligibility process and subsidy related tasks from application review, eligibility determination, re-determination for continued care, data entry, and/or completion of child care arrangement in addition to processing termination of coverage. The incumbent is responsible for continuous case management services, making client-driven changes in cases involving eligibility or other pertinent information affecting services, such as a change in household income, family size, child care provider selection, employment hours, and the like. As necessary, will generate recoupments and complete related reports. The Eligibility Program Specialist promotes high-quality consumer education throughout the delivery system.
